
Purpose refers to our direction in life – our goals, values, strengths, and beliefs. Knowing and living our personal and community purpose increases motivation and fulfillment, and leads to a greater connection to ourselves, others, and the world around us.

Learning Outcomes
As a result of our programs and services, students will be able to:
- Discuss what factors influence their values and identities
- Explore vocational possibilities
- Articulate how their purpose contributes to their communities
